dc.description.abstractThe granite–leucogranite plutons traditionally recognized as the Irakan Complex are widespread in the Stanovoi Terrane [1]. This plutonic association comprises (I) biotite–hornblende quartz monzodiorite, (II) biotite–hornblende granite, and (III) biotite-bearing leucogranite and subalkali leucogranite intrusive phases. According to the K–Ar datings, phase II is composed of Early Cretaceous granites, while phase III includes Late Cretaceous leucogranites. Gold placers and gold–tungsten and molybdenum ore occurrences are spatially associated with granite–leucogranite plutons.
